The aerospace and defence sectors are at the forefront of technological innovation, international commerce and national security. At CMS, we provide comprehensive legal counsel to clients operating in these industries, whether they are established market leaders or emerging innovators.

We bring together a multidisciplinary team of legal professionals with deep experience in regulatory compliance, government contracts, international trade, litigation, intellectual property and corporate transactions. We help clients navigate the complexities of export controls, defence contracting, cybersecurity requirements and evolving international laws.

With years of advising aircraft manufacturers, defence contractors, suppliers and government agencies, our legal team understands the legal challenges specific to the aerospace and defence industries. We provide proactive solutions, guiding our clients through critical decisions and helping them mitigate risks in a rapidly changing global environment.
